I've owned a set of those EXACT wheels. They are NOT dual bolt pattern wheels. Look at the lug holes man, there are only 5 lug holes. How is a wheel with 5 lug holes going to fit on a 4 lug hub? IT WON'T! The other holes drilled around the hub area aren't even large enough for wheel studs to pass through them, are not machined for tapered lug nuts, and are also spaced evenly in a 5-lug pattern. Where it says 4x114.3 on the back of the wheels is just for loading information so they don't have to make a new mold for a 4-lug wheel. This isn't rocket science man, it's COMMON SENSE...
